WebBowel screening aims to find cancer at an early stage when treatment is likely to be more effective. Early detection is key. At least 9 out of 10 people will survive bowel cancer if it’s found and treated early. WebSep 19, 2024 · Faecal immunochemical test (FIT) rollout to all UK countries. Scotland introduced FIT screening in November 2024, since when the number of people responding to screening invitations has increased. FIT screening is due to replace the old faecal occult blood (FOB) test from June 2024 in Wales and from later in 2024 in England.
